2 Acceptances, help me choose by Possible-Article-312 in Osteopathic

[–]OppositeBit8158 3 points4 points  (0 children)

I would probably say WCUCOM. VCOM is more strict with mandatory attendance and a dress code, and I believe they have 2 tests a week. WCUCOM is P/F, so it is less stressful, and it is decently cheap. Both have great match rates. WCUCOM has lower board pass rates though, but I heard it’s been improving over the years. I will say though VCOM-Auburn looks nice and is in a better location in my opinion.
